A TALE OF TWO SERIES

Dwight Howard’s complete 180 degree performance from the Charlotte series to the Atlanta series has the Orlando Magic looking like the team that no one wants to face in these playoffs. See for yourself:














Vs. Bobcats:           |         Vs. Hawks:

Game 1: 5pts, 7rebs, 9blks, 5 fouls    |  Game 1: 21pts, 12rebs, 5blks, 3 fouls
Game 2: 15pts, 9rebs, 2blks, 5 fouls  |  Game 2: 29pts, 17rebs, 1blk, 5 fouls

Game 3: 13pts, 8rebs, 7blks, fouled out |  Game 3: 21pts, 16rebs, 1blk, 4 fouls

Game 4: 6pts, 13rebs, 2blks, fouled out  | Game 4: 13pts, 8rebs, 4blks, 4 fouls

Although there is a slight similarity in the amount of fouls Howard has committed, the total minutes played in those 2 series’ are far from similar. Not to mention Dwight averaged a staggering 83.4% (27-32 fgs) in the Atlanta series.
With the best team in basketball & a bitter taste in their mouths, the Orlando Magic seemed poised for a consecutive trip to the NBA Finals. This time they expect the outcome to be different.
